|
Lease Commitments - Scheule of Information Related to Finance Leases Recorded on the Consolidated Balance Sheets (Details) - USD ($)
$ in Thousands
|
Dec. 31, 2024
|
Dec. 31, 2023
|Financing leases:
|Non-utility property
|$ 50,144
|$ 49,981
|Accumulated depreciation
|$ (24,604)
|$ (23,905)
|Finance Lease, Right-of-Use Asset, Statement of Financial Position [Extensible Enumeration]
|Non-utility property, including financing leases
|Non-utility property, including financing leases
|Non-utility property, net
|$ 25,540
|$ 26,076
|Finance Lease, Liability, Current, Statement of Financial Position [Extensible Enumeration]
|Other current liabilities
|Other current liabilities
|Other current liabilities
|$ 9,126
|$ 8,776
|Finance Lease, Liability, Noncurrent, Statement of Financial Position [Extensible Enumeration]
|Other deferred credits
|Other deferred credits
|Other deferred credits
|$ 16,470
|$ 17,326
|PNM
|Financing leases:
|Non-utility property
|24,548
|25,425
|Accumulated depreciation
|(10,997)
|(11,984)
|Non-utility property, net
|$ 13,551
|$ 13,441
|Finance Lease, Liability, Current, Statement of Financial Position [Extensible Enumeration]
|Other current liabilities
|Other current liabilities
|Other current liabilities
|$ 4,311
|$ 4,146
|Finance Lease, Liability, Noncurrent, Statement of Financial Position [Extensible Enumeration]
|Other deferred credits
|Other deferred credits
|Other deferred credits
|$ 9,262
|$ 9,300
|TNMP
|Financing leases:
|Non-utility property
|24,420
|24,487
|Accumulated depreciation
|(13,411)
|(11,869)
|Non-utility property, net
|$ 11,009
|$ 12,618
|Finance Lease, Liability, Current, Statement of Financial Position [Extensible Enumeration]
|Other current liabilities
|Other current liabilities
|Other current liabilities
|$ 4,527
|$ 4,616
|Finance Lease, Liability, Noncurrent, Statement of Financial Position [Extensible Enumeration]
|Other deferred credits
|Other deferred credits
|Other deferred credits
|$ 6,504
|$ 8,023
|X
- Definition
+ References
Finance Lease, Assets and Liabilities, Lessee [Abstract]
+ Details
No definition available.
|X
- Definition
+ References
Finance Lease, Liability, Current, Other
+ Details
No definition available.
|X
- Definition
+ References
Finance Lease, Liability, Deferred Credits, Other
+ Details
No definition available.
|X
- Definition
+ References
Finance Lease, Right-Of-Use Asset, Accumulated Depreciation
+ Details
No definition available.
|X
- Definition
+ References
Finance Lease, Right-Of-Use Asset, Gross
+ Details
No definition available.
|X
- Definition
+ References
Indicates line item in statement of financial position that includes current finance lease liability.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Indicates line item in statement of financial position that includes noncurrent finance lease liability.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ount, after accumulated amortization, of right-of-use asset from finance lease.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Indicates line item in statement of financial position that includes finance lease right-of-use asset.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Details
|X
- Details